Abstract

A successive approximation resistor analog digital converter (SAR ADC) includes a first conversion unit including a correction capacitor array and a bit capacitor array 2less than the number of a bit, a second conversion unit configured to differentially operate with the first conversion unit, a comparator configured to output a voltage of a high level or a low level of each capacitor according to output voltages of the first and second conversion units, a successive approximation register (SAR) logic unit configured to receive an output voltage of the comparator to convert the received output voltage into a digital signal, and a correction logic unit configured to receive the digital signal converted by the SAR logic unit and to correct a digital signal of the bit capacitor array using a correction digital signal of the correction capacitor array of the received digital signal.
